#28191e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28191e is composed of 15.7% red, 9.8%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 25% yellow and 84.3%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 23.1% and a lightness of 12.7%. #28191e color hex could be obtained by blending #50323c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#28191e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28191e has RGB values of R:40, G:25,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.25, K:0.84. Its decimal value is 2627870.

Shades and Tints of #28191e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040203 is the darkest color, while #faf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#28191e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#231e20 is the less saturated color, while #410016 is the most saturated one.
